We all know the typical indgrindets and making of our beloved breakfast food - the Shakshuka:


1 tbsp olive oil.

1/2 onion, peeled and diced.

1 clove garlic, minced.

1 bell pepper, seeded and chopped.

4 cups ripe diced tomatoes, or 2 cans (14 oz. each) diced tomatoes.

2 tbsp tomato paste.

1 tsp mild chili powder.

1 tsp cumin.

Shakshuka is traditionally served for breakfast with warm pita bread, challah, or naan. Also pairs well with hummus, grits, roasted potatoes, herb salad, cucumber salad, or Greek salad.
